RESUMEN

INTRODUCTION: inhibitors of tumor necrosis factor alpha (anti-TNFs) are effective drugs for the treatment of moderate-to-severe ulcerative colitis (UC). However, many patients do not respond or lose therapeutic response during follow-up. OBJECTIVES: to analyze the determining factors of clinical response to anti-TNFs in UC. METHODS: a multicenter retrospective study was performed in 79 patients with UC who started treatment with anti-TNFs between 2009 and 2015. The primary endpoint was clinical remission (pMayo index ≤ 1) at 12 months. Furthermore, remission and clinical response (final pMayo score ≤ 3) and corticoids discontinuation were assessed at three, six and 12 months. An analysis was performed to identify variables predictive of clinical response. RESULTS: at 12 months, remission and clinical response were seen in 59.2 % and 77.8 % of patients, respectively. Corticoids could be discontinued in 82.4 % of patients. At 12 months, corticoids discontinuation (< 3 months) (OR 0.06; 95 % CI: 0.01-0.24) and clinical response at six months (OR 0.008; 95 % CI: 0.001-0.053) were independent factors predictive of clinical remission. CONCLUSION: in patients with active UC on anti-TNFs, corticoid discontinuation within three months and clinical response at six months after treatment onset are predictive of clinical disease remission.

RESUMEN

Thrombin activation and microthrombosis of intrahepatic portal venules is a common feature in liver cirrhosis, due in part to relative protein C deficiency and altered coagulation-anticoagulation-fibrinolysis balance. Extension of this microthrombotic process to larger portal vessels explains the increased incidence of portal vein thrombosis in liver cirrhosis. Thrombin not only leads to thrombosis, but also activates liver stellate cells and promotes fibrogenesis. Also, ischemia associated with thrombosis up-regulates the expression and secretion of growth factors involved in fibrogenesis. The coincidence in a given patient of prothrombotic mutations, such as factor V Leiden or PAI-1 polymorphisms, can accelerate the fibrogenetic process. We hereby present two cases of liver cirrhosis in which etiologic evaluation was negative except for the finding of a factor V Leiden mutation in one case and the 4G/5G PAI polymorphism in the second case. These observations support the hypothesis that these mutations may be involved in the etiology of some cases of cirrhosis, or, at least, accelerate the evolution of the disease. It is therefore convenient to search for the presence of prothrombotic mutations in patients with cryptogenetic cirrhosis.
